Five Homes Pummeled with Paintballs on Park Drive

Residents wake up to find yellow paint on homes.

 

Five separate homes were pummeled with paintballs on Park Drive last week. 

Around 8 a.m. on June 19 police talked to residents at five different homes on the street whose homes were spattered with yellow paintballs, and in one incident a resident’s Dodge Ram was also hit while it was parked in a driveway.

The female resident whose car was hit said to police that at approximately 1 a.m. on June 19 she had awoken to the sound of a car starting its engine on the street across from her home. The car was described by the resident as a grey or silver four-door sedan with two men inside. 

Police canvassed the neighborhood for details or leads, but no resident could provide any information.

Capt. John Buoye from the West Orange Police Deparment said police have nothing to go on at this time, and the incidents are still under investigation.

While Buoye said these were random incidents, he added there have been incidents in the past with paintball guns -- usually involving juveniles. 

Any resident with information about these cases can contact the police department at (973) 325-4000, or the department’s detective bureau at (973) 325-4020.
